On Thu, 2016-09-29 at 10:02 -0500, Jason Nelson wrote:
> Just wanting to know if this is being looked into, or if I've somehow
> worked myself onto a blacklist?  I'm getting this from multiple end points,
> though.

We disabled direct download from yum.postgresql.org, as we asked all users to
use download.postgresql.org since last year. Details are here:

http://people.planetpostgresql.org/devrim/index.php?/archives/92-Lots-of-changes-at-yum.PostgreSQL.org.html

The repo files that we pushed last year already has up2date repo links. Please
let me know if you need more info.
